Planar Monopole Antenna with Modified Ground Plane for UWB Communications (UWB 통신을 위한 변형된 접지 면을 갖는 평판형 모노폴 안테나)

A CPW-Fed Ultra-Wideband Planar Monopole Antenna for UHF Band Applications (UHF 대역용 CPW 급전 초광대역 평면형 모노폴 안테나)

  • In this paper, a novel ultra-wideband planar monopole antenna for the UHF communications and Digital-TV reception is proposed. The proposed antenna fed by a coplanar waveguide(CPW) is based on a triangular patch that has a broadband characteristic. To further increase the bandwidth of the triangular patch antenna, the top side of the regular triangular patch is loaded with a notch cut and each oblique side with a step. In addition, a slope is given to the ground plane of the CPW structure. Experimental results show that the -10 dB return loss bandwidth of the proposed antenna is 2,320 MHz from 480~2,800 MHz(5.83:1 bandwidth), which covers all the frequency bands of the various wireless communication systems and Digital TV broadcasting in the UHF band. Within the entire operating frequency range, the measured antenna gain in y-z plane(E-plane) varies from 3.01 to 4.71 dBi.

Wideband Double-Radiator Circular Disc Annular Monopole Antenna

  • A wideband double radiator circular disc annular monopole antenna is proposed is this work. The radiators are etched on the surfaces of two Taconic TLY-5 substrates with a circular hole cut out of each of the radiators initially at the centers of the radiators with subsequent downward displacement of the holes. The antenna is designed with a two-step feeding transformer system for impedance matching between the input power source supplied by a $50-{\Omega}$ SMA connector and the monopole radiators. The transformer system improves the bandwidth performance at higher frequencies. The proposed antenna achieves a wideband having the capability of working between 0.645 and 18.775 GHz, corresponding to a -10 dB bandwidth of 186.7% with gain ranging from 0.95 to 8.26 dBi. In comparison to other metal disc planar monopole antennas, the proposed antenna has a small total size width due to the size of the ground plane, which has a diameter 100 mm. The frequency range of the antenna provides applications in global positioning systems, mobile communications, ultra-wideband short distance communications, and wireless computer networks.

Design and Trend Analysis According to the Application Field of Monopole Antenna with Sleeve Structure (슬리브 구조를 갖는 모노폴 안테나의 활용분야에 따른 설계와 동향분석)

  • This paper summarizes the data of a monopole antenna with a sleeve structure that can be applied in various ways. Sleeve monopole antennas have broadband characteristics and are used for multi-frequency applications. The sleeve monopole antenna is composed of a vertical conductor, which is a radiator, and a sleeve having the same structure as a coaxial cable. The sleeve acts as a radiator and an open stub. The length of the sleeve should be 1/3~2/3 of the total length of the antenna. A monopole antenna having a sleeve structure is applicable to a vehicle wiper antenna. In addition, the case of applying this antenna to a broadband sleeve antenna using a loading coil, a broadband printed sleeve monopole antenna for an ISM band, a gap sleeve and a double sleeve, and a UWB planar monopole antenna using half cutting was summarized and analyzed in terms of structure and broadband.
